Jet Engine Mechanic Jobs 2026: A Comprehensive Guide

The Indian government, primarily through its defense forces and associated technical organizations, frequently recruits skilled Jet Engine Mechanics. These roles are vital for the upkeep of aircraft and ensuring flight safety and efficiency. For 2026, candidates with the right technical qualifications and aptitude can explore government service in this specialized field.

Job Profile & Responsibilities

A Jet Engine Mechanic in government service is primarily responsible for the inspection, maintenance, repair, and overhaul of jet engines and related aircraft systems. Their key duties include:

  • Performing routine engine checks and diagnostic tests.
  • Disassembling, inspecting, cleaning, and reassembling engine components.
  • Identifying and rectifying mechanical defects, malfunctions, and wear and tear.
  • Interpreting technical manuals, blueprints, and schematics.
  • Ensuring compliance with all safety regulations and quality control standards.
  • Carrying out scheduled and unscheduled maintenance tasks on aircraft engines.
  • Documenting all maintenance activities accurately.

Eligibility Criteria (Detailed)

The eligibility criteria for Jet Engine Mechanic positions in government organizations generally include:

  • Educational Qualification: Candidates typically require a Diploma in Mechanical Engineering, Aeronautical Engineering, or a related field from a recognized polytechnic or institution. In some cases, a certificate from Industrial Training Institutes (ITIs) in relevant trades like Aircraft Maintenance or Engine Fitter is also considered. A background in Physics and Mathematics at the 10+2 level is often a prerequisite.
  • Technical Skills: Proficiency in understanding technical drawings, using precision tools, and operating diagnostic equipment is essential. Familiarity with aircraft maintenance procedures and safety protocols is crucial.
  • Age Limit: The typical age limit for entry-level positions is between 18 and 25 years. Age relaxations are provided for candidates belonging to Scheduled Castes (SC), Scheduled Tribes (ST), Other Backward Classes (OBC), Ex-Servicemen, and Persons with Disabilities (PwD) as per government norms.
  • Physical Standards: Government roles, especially in defense, require candidates to meet specific physical fitness standards, including good vision and no major physical ailments.

Selection Process & Exam Pattern

The selection process for Jet Engine Mechanic roles usually involves multiple stages designed to assess technical knowledge, aptitude, and physical fitness:

  • Phase 1: Screening/Written Examination: Candidates are typically required to pass a written test covering general intelligence, reasoning, quantitative aptitude, English, and technical subjects related to mechanical and aeronautical engineering.
  • Phase 2: Skill Test/Practical Assessment: Candidates who qualify in the written exam undergo a skill test to evaluate their practical abilities in engine maintenance, assembly, and repair.
  • Phase 3: Medical Examination: Rigorous medical tests are conducted to ensure candidates meet the required physical and health standards.
  • Phase 4: Interview (if applicable): Some organizations may conduct a personal interview to assess a candidate's suitability for the role.

Likely Exam Syllabus Topics: Basic Mechanical Engineering, Thermodynamics, Fluid Mechanics, Aircraft Systems, Principles of Jet Propulsion, Workshop Technology, Basic Electrical & Electronics Engineering, General Knowledge, and Reasoning.

Salary Structure & Allowances

Jet Engine Mechanics recruited by government organizations are usually placed in Pay Level-4. The basic pay ranges from Rs. 25,500 to Rs. 81,100 per month. In addition to the basic pay, employees receive various allowances as per government regulations, which may include:

  • Dearness Allowance (DA)
  • House Rent Allowance (HRA)
  • Transport Allowance (TA)
  • Risk and Hardship Allowances (especially in defense roles)
  • Other benefits like medical facilities, leave travel concession, and pension schemes.

How to Apply for Jet Engine Mechanic Vacancies

Government vacancies for Jet Engine Mechanic roles are typically announced by specific organizations. To apply:

  • Monitor Official Websites: Regularly check the official career portals of the Indian Air Force (indianairforce.nic.in), Indian Navy (joinindiannavy.gov.in), Hindustan Aeronautics Limited (hal-india.co.in), and DRDO (drdo.gov.in).
  • Broader Technical Entries: Keep an eye on notifications for Technical Entry Schemes or civilian recruitment drives conducted by these bodies.
  • Application Process: Applications are usually invited through online modes. Candidates need to register, fill out the application form with accurate details, upload necessary documents (certificates, photos, signature), and pay the application fee if prescribed.
  • Notification Specifics: Always refer to the specific advertisement for detailed application instructions, deadlines, and required documents.
